Imagine a world where your written content comes alive, speaking directly to your audience in a voice that resonates with them. This is not just a dream; it’s a reality made possible by AWS Text to Speech. In this comprehensive guide, we will explore the ins and outs of AWS Text to Speech, how it works, its applications, and why it is a game-changer for businesses and individuals alike.
What is AWS Text to Speech?
AWS Text to Speech is a cloud-based service provided by Amazon Web Services that converts written text into lifelike speech. Utilizing advanced deep learning technologies, this service generates high-quality audio outputs that sound remarkably natural. Whether you need to create voiceovers for videos, enhance accessibility for visually impaired users, or even generate personalized audio messages, AWS Text to Speech can cater to all these needs and more.
Why Choose AWS Text to Speech?
Choosing AWS Text to Speech comes with a multitude of benefits that set it apart from other text-to-speech services. Here are some compelling reasons:
-
Natural Sounding Voices: AWS offers a variety of voices that sound human-like, making your audio content engaging.
-
Multiple Languages and Accents: With support for numerous languages and accents, you can reach a global audience.
-
Customization Options: Users can modify speech parameters such as pitch, speed, and volume to suit their specific needs.
-
Integration with Other AWS Services: Easily integrate with other AWS services like Amazon Polly and AWS Lambda for enhanced functionality.
How Does AWS Text to Speech Work?
AWS Text to Speech operates through a simple API that developers can easily integrate into their applications. Here’s a step-by-step breakdown of how it works:
-
Input Text: Users provide the text they want to convert into speech.
-
API Call: An API request is made to AWS, specifying the desired voice, language, and other parameters.
-
Processing: AWS processes the text using deep learning models to generate speech.
-
Output: The audio file is returned in various formats, including MP3 and OGG, ready for use.
What Formats Does AWS Text to Speech Support?
AWS Text to Speech supports multiple audio formats, ensuring that users have flexibility in how they utilize the generated speech. Common formats include:
-
MP3: Widely used for music and audio files, compatible with most devices.
-
OGG: An open-source format that offers high-quality audio.
-
PCM: Uncompressed audio format for high fidelity.
Applications of AWS Text to Speech
The versatility of AWS Text to Speech makes it applicable in various fields. Here are some notable applications:
1. Accessibility
One of the most significant benefits of AWS Text to Speech is its ability to enhance accessibility. By converting written content into speech, it allows visually impaired individuals to access information that would otherwise be unavailable to them. This is particularly valuable in educational settings, where students can listen to textbooks and learning materials.
2. Content Creation
For content creators, AWS Text to Speech offers a powerful tool for generating voiceovers for videos, podcasts, and audiobooks. This service saves time and resources, enabling creators to focus on other aspects of their projects while ensuring high-quality audio output.
3. Customer Support
Businesses can integrate AWS Text to Speech into their customer support systems, providing automated responses in a natural voice. This enhances user experience and reduces wait times for customers seeking assistance.
4. E-Learning
In the realm of e-learning, AWS Text to Speech can be used to create engaging audio lessons that cater to auditory learners. This technology can help make online courses more interactive and enjoyable.
5. Marketing
Marketers can utilize AWS Text to Speech to create personalized audio messages for their campaigns. This can be particularly effective in email marketing, where a personal touch can significantly enhance engagement rates.
Getting Started with AWS Text to Speech
If you're eager to start using AWS Text to Speech, follow these steps:
Step 1: Create an AWS Account
To use AWS Text to Speech, you first need to create an account on the AWS platform. This involves providing your email address, setting a password, and entering payment information.
Step 2: Access the AWS Management Console
Once your account is set up, log in to the AWS Management Console. Here, you will find a plethora of services offered by AWS, including Text to Speech.
Step 3: Navigate to Amazon Polly
AWS Text to Speech is powered by Amazon Polly. Search for "Amazon Polly" in the services menu and click to access it.
Step 4: Input Your Text
In the Amazon Polly console, you’ll find a text box where you can input the text you want to convert into speech. You can also select the voice and language preferences.
Step 5: Generate Speech
After inputting your text and selecting your preferences, click the "Synthesize Speech" button. Within moments, AWS will generate the audio file, which you can download and use as needed.
FAQs about AWS Text to Speech
What is the cost of using AWS Text to Speech?
The cost of using AWS Text to Speech is based on the number of characters processed. AWS offers a free tier that allows you to convert up to 5 million characters per month for free for the first year.
Can I use AWS Text to Speech for commercial purposes?
Yes, you can use AWS Text to Speech for commercial purposes. However, it is essential to review the AWS Service Terms to ensure compliance with their policies.
Are there any limitations to the service?
While AWS Text to Speech is highly versatile, there are some limitations. For instance, the quality of the generated speech may vary depending on the complexity of the text and the selected voice.
How do I integrate AWS Text to Speech into my application?
Integrating AWS Text to Speech into your application involves using the AWS SDKs or REST APIs. AWS provides comprehensive documentation to guide you through the integration process.
Conclusion
In a world where communication is key, AWS Text to Speech stands out as a powerful tool that bridges the gap between written content and auditory experience. By transforming text into natural speech, it opens up a myriad of possibilities for accessibility, content creation, customer support, e-learning, and marketing. Whether you are a developer, educator, marketer, or content creator, AWS Text to Speech can elevate your projects and enhance engagement with your audience.
As technology continues to evolve, services like AWS Text to Speech will play an increasingly vital role in how we share information and connect with one another. Embrace the future of communication and explore the potential of AWS Text to Speech today!